Mechanism of Action
This ingredient operates as a sulfosuccinate surfactant, effectively lowering the surface tension between water and hydrophobic substances like skin oils and environmental dirt. This action allows for the emulsification and suspension of these impurities, facilitating their efficient rinsing from the skin's surface.

Stability
Sulfosuccinates, including Dipotassium Lauryl Sulfosuccinate, are susceptible to degradation at high temperatures. To maintain stability, avoid prolonged storage at elevated temperatures and refrain from incorporating into very high-temperature processing stages.

Safety Profile
The Cosmetic Ingredient Review (CIR) Expert Panel concluded that Dipotassium Lauryl Sulfosuccinate is safe for use in cosmetic products when formulated to be non-irritating. The panel highlighted that sulfosuccinates generally have the potential to cause ocular or skin irritation if not properly incorporated into the product, but are not associated with sensitization.
